Pricing and Criteria of Agent Services

When looking into registered agent options, grasping the pricing is important. cheapest registered agent for hiring a registered agent can differ substantially according to the provider and the level of service offered. On average, firms can reckon to pay ranging from fifty and $300 each year. Some corporations may even face additional costs if they demand specific services like compliance reminders or yearly report submissions. Exploring reviews of registered agent providers can provide insights into the best options for the most value.

Registered agent requirements vary from location, making it important for company leaders to know their jurisdictional rules. In general, states mandate that a registered agent be a citizen of the area or a company authorized to operate there. Furthermore, the registered agent must have a physical address, known as the agent's office, where legal papers can be received. It is essential to verify that your selected registered agent adheres to these criteria to avoid complications with compliance.

Benefits of Hiring a Reliable Registered Agent

Engaging a dependable registered agent is a tactical move for every business organization. A reliable registered agent ensures adherence with state regulations and helps maintain your business's good standing. By handling legal documents and service of process, a competent registered agent shields business owners from overlooking critical deadlines, such as annual report filings and other compliance reminders. This forward-thinking approach minimizes the risk of penalties and helps your business stay on track.

One major benefit of hiring a registered agent is the confidentiality it offers. A registered agent provides a layer of secrecy by receiving legal documents on behalf of your business at their registered office. This keeps your personal address confidential and prevents excessive attention from the public eye. Additionally, businesses operating in multiple states benefit from a multi-state registered agent, which consolidates compliance management across jurisdictions, allowing for more efficient operations and less bureaucratic burden.

Adherence and Regulatory Responsibilities

Registered agents play a significant role in ensuring that businesses adhere with various legal requirements. They act as a firm's designated representative for managing important legal documents and legal notifications delivery. anonymous registered agent service keeps business owners aware of any legal actions or obligations that may arise, helping companies adhere to their statutory filing deadlines and avoid penalties. A dependable registered agent ensures that all compliance notifications are timely delivered and that the business remains in good standing with state regulations.

The registered agent company must also maintain a registered office address where they can be contacted during regular business hours. This obligation helps establish a stable presence for the business in the state of incorporation, which is essential for maintaining compliance with state laws. Failure to have a compliant registered agent can lead to major issues, including losing the right to operate in the state, incurring additional fees, or facing litigious consequences.
